University Grants Commission (UGC) guidelines require specific grade mapping distributions across institutions in Bangladesh. Check standard structural evaluation parameters below:
| Numerical Score | Letter Grade | Grade Point Value |
|---|---|---|
| 80% and Above | A+ | 4.00 |
| 75% to less than 80% | A | 3.75 |
| 70% to less than 75% | A- | 3.50 |
| 65% to less than 70% | B+ | 3.25 |
| 60% to less than 65% | B | 3.00 |
| 55% to less than 60% | B- | 2.75 |
| 50% to less than 55% | C+ | 2.50 |
| 45% to less than 50% | C | 2.25 |
| 40% to less than 45% | D | 2.00 |
| Less than 40% | F | 0.00 |

Calculation Mechanics: Individual grade weights are multiplied by their respective course credit values. The total across all classes is then divided by your overall registered credit hours to determine your exact grade point average.
